Shakhtar Donetsk appointed Roberto De Zerbi as his new coach. The news had been in the air for weeks, now it's official. The italian boss arrived after a three year experience with Sassuolo in Serie A.

“During his two-day visit, Roberto De Dzerby will get acquainted with the infrastructure in the capital of Ukraine - the Pitmen's training complex in Svyatoshino and NSC Olimpiyskiy, where the team plays their home games. The Italian became the 34th head coach in the history of Shakhtar.

Roberto De Zerbi was born on June 6, 1979 in Brescia. He started his player career in the youth team of Milan. He played for Monza (1998), Padova (1998-2000), Avellino (2000-2001; 2008-2009), Lecco (2001-2002), Foggia (2002-2004), Arezzo (2004-2005), Catania (2005-2006), Napoli (2006-2008; 2009-2010), Brescia (2008), Romanian Cluj (2010-2012) and Trento (2013).

Coach career: Darfo Boario (2013–2014), Foggia (2014–2016), Palermo (2016), Benevento (2017–2018), Sassuolo (2018–2021)”, the club wrote.
